About Oceano County

Oceano County (L52) in California is a publicly owned, non-towered airport with a small asphalt runway. One runway, 11/29, measures 2,325 by 50 feet. No published approaches. Visual flight rules only. Arriving and departing aircraft self-announce on common traffic advisory frequency 122.7 MHz. Fuel includes 100LL avgas. Field elevation is 14 feet above mean sea level.
